  • House sales hit 40 year low amid cost of living crunch
    par Staff le 21/03/2023 à 10:52

    Interest rate hikes and tighter lending rules have triggered the biggest property sales slump in nearly 40 years. Figures from CoreLogic NZ show 60,859 properties were sold in the year to February 2023 – the lowest 12-month total since October 1983. For the month of February alone, about […]
